Here’s five things to know this weekend:

1. Falcons rookie mini-camp begins on Friday

With the start of the Atlanta Falcons' rookie mini-camp on Friday, D. Orlando Ledbetter writes about one rookie you should keep your eye on— Central Arkansas cornerback Tyler Williams. Ledbetter reports on his conversation with Williams on the AJC.com.

2. Braves begin series with Marlins

After losing six-straight games, the Atlanta Braves begin a three-game series with the Miami Marlins on Friday night. Friday's game is scheduled to begin at 7:10 p.m. The Braves and Marlins play the second and third games in the series on Saturday evening and Sunday afternoon.

3. Falcons agree to terms with 2017 draft class

D. Orlando Ledbetter reports the Falcons agreed to terms with Takkarist McKinley, Duke Riley, Brian Hill and Eric Saubert on Thursday evening. Damontae Kazee and Sean Harlow reached deals with the Falcons prior to Thursday.

4. Notre Dame, ACC announced football matchups set for next 20 seasons

All football matchups between Notre Dame and ACC schools through 2037 were announced on Wedneday. Georgia Tech is scheduled to play Notre Dame six times over the next 20 years. The full list of matchups from 2026-2037 can be read on the AJC.com.

5. Predicting Atlanta United's starters

Atlanta United plays the Portland Timbers on Sunday and Doug Roberson predicts Atlanta United's starters. The match is scheduled to begin at 4 p.m.
